pulseaudio: A low-level (incomplete) wrapper around the pulseaudio client asynchronous api

This is a package candidate release! Here you can preview how this package release will appear once published to the main package index (which can be accomplished via the 'maintain' link below). Please note that once a package has been published to the main package index it cannot be undone! Please consult the package uploading documentation for more information.

[maintain]

This package mainly exists, because I wanted to query the current system volume from the pulse audio server.

Doing this required me to build at least the core of the pulse api.

This package is provided as is, with very little testing and only a small subset of the pulse api implemented. Expanding this package *should* be rather easy. At least for query/control. If you are interested in doing this, but don't know how, feel free to contact me.

In package is a bit unrefined and rough. If you have better structure for modules feel free to reorganize them and making a PR. This also means, don't see this structur as fixed yet, it may change if someone has a better idea.

Properties

Versions0.0.1.0, 0.0.1.1, 0.0.2.0, 0.0.2.1, 0.0.2.1
Change logChangeLog.md
Dependenciesbase (>=4.6.0.1 && <5), containers, pulseaudio, stm, transformers, unix [details]
LicenseLGPL-3.0-only
AuthorMarkus Ongyerth
Maintainerongy@ongy.net
CategorySound
Source repositoryhead: git clone https://github.com/ongy/pulseaudio
Executablespulse-test
UploadedFri Sep 29 06:11:57 UTC 2017 by ongyerth

Modules

[Index]

Downloads

Maintainers' corner

For package maintainers and hackage trustees